IP查询
查询
你查询的IP:[218.5.171.70] 地理位置:中国–福建–泉州
最新查询
121.8.149.209
125.96.219.96
210.76.235.136
222.176.131.73
60.43.121.103
219.216.234.145
117.58.115.132
119.19.86.157
119.17.139.211
218.5.171.70
60.253.128.206
123.138.7.119
219.72.143.69
117.80.225.24
119.235.128.161
202.38.184.153
222.16.3.213
124.6.64.93
202.189.80.157
123.8.92.236
202.43.144.133
218.192.35.155
125.213.186.209
116.194.187.110
203.208.100.147
125.96.134.193
221.200.248.111
203.80.144.166
202.69.4.66
125.214.96.37
202.127.216.4